/bye bye motor
 
Pretty certain I woofed my motor tonight :( I was pulling on some F Body and afterwards had problems.

These past few weeks my idle has been screwy, bouncing between 5-800 all the time at idle, with vacuum bouncing between 8-12 Hg. After the F Body race I shut it off for a while, then tried starting it maybe 30 minutes later. It dies about 2 seconds after idle, and only has about 8 Hg vacuum and the idle bouncing all over again. I am seeing some black smoke on startup which leads me to believe a compression problem.

I did check my map sensor and it's tight so that's not the problem. I also just changed my plugs 2 weeks (less then 200 miles ago) to NGK 9's all the way around.

The motor has 51k miles on it. Almost exactly a year ago I had a compression test and it was 1st rotor 8.3, 8.3, 8.3. Second 7.9, 7.9, 7.7. Since then I have driven about 5k miles, and added a Catback, Midpipe, FMIC, Nippendenso Fuel Pump, Pulley Kit, boost controller, removed Airpump and a remapped Rotary Performance ECU. I run 12 PSI daily and keep my silencer in my exhaust to control my boost creep. I suppose these mods are a contributing factor.

Guess I will take it into Mazda tomorrow for a compression check, but my gut feeling is a bad seal. Any ideas before I take it for it's compression check? Hopefully I can squeeze some blood money from the warranty company.

Results
 
Got my results today.

Front Rotor: 8.2, 8.3, 8.3
Rear Rotor: 5.8, 6.6, 7.4

Seeing these numbers I guess I can still probably drive on it for a while. I guess my plan will be to get a street port. Now I get the fun of dealing with the warranty company :D
